USGS

Isis 3.0 Application Source Code Reference

Home

AbstractNumberFilter Class Reference

Base class for filters that are number-based. More...

#include <AbstractNumberFilter.h>

List of all members.

Public Member Functions

 AbstractNumberFilter (AbstractFilter::FilterEffectivenessFlag, int minimumForSuccess=-1)
 AbstractNumberFilter (const AbstractNumberFilter &other)
virtual ~AbstractNumberFilter ()

Protected Member Functions

bool evaluate (double) const
QString descriptionSuffix () const
bool lessThan () const

Detailed Description

Base class for filters that are number-based.

This class is the base class that all filters that are number-based.

Author:
????-??-?? Eric Hyer

Definition at line 31 of file AbstractNumberFilter.h.


Constructor & Destructor Documentation

AbstractNumberFilter ( AbstractFilter::FilterEffectivenessFlag  flag,
int  minimumForSuccess = -1 
)

Definition at line 24 of file AbstractNumberFilter.cpp.

AbstractNumberFilter ( const AbstractNumberFilter other  ) 

Definition at line 33 of file AbstractNumberFilter.cpp.

~AbstractNumberFilter (  )  [virtual]

Definition at line 46 of file AbstractNumberFilter.cpp.


Member Function Documentation

bool evaluate ( double  number  )  const [protected]

Definition at line 108 of file AbstractNumberFilter.cpp.

QString descriptionSuffix (  )  const [protected]

Definition at line 125 of file AbstractNumberFilter.cpp.

bool lessThan (  )  const [protected]

Definition at line 145 of file AbstractNumberFilter.cpp.


The documentation for this class was generated from the following files: